SAEDNEWS: Axios reported that Washington has observed no violations by Hamas in the recent agreement—a finding that contradicts claims by the Israeli regime, which used these allegations as a pretext for tonight’s extensive attacks on the Gaza Strip.
According to the political news service of Saed News, Axios reported that a “senior U.S. official” told Israeli authorities that Washington has seen no evidence of Hamas violating the agreement that would require a response.
The official also urged Israel to refrain from radical actions that could lead to the collapse of the ceasefire.
In a blatant breach of the truce, the Israeli regime carried out heavy attacks on multiple locations in the Gaza Strip, following repeated threats by its officials throughout the day.
According to the report, Israeli warplanes conducted two airstrikes in the northern and southern Gaza Strip, while Israeli artillery targeted areas east of Deir al-Balah in central Gaza.
Following these attacks, hospital sources in Gaza reported that nine people have been killed and 15 others injured so far.
The report noted that the strikes were concentrated on Gaza City and Khan Younis in the southern Gaza Strip.
